### Step 4: Reconfigure the bounce processor

Before cutting traffic to the new Pellwright bounce processor, confirm that suppression-list writes are authenticated and that the webhook verifier rejects unsigned payloads. The legacy service accepted plaintext callbacks, which this migration eliminates. Audit the retry queue permissions as well, since bounce records contain recipient metadata. Once verified, apply the settings shown below.

deployment values, bagaf-kagag:
istael:
  pin: 2777
  tenant: tamvan
  seal: seal_75cefd5e
  metrics_host: metrics.istael.qirvanio.example
  standby_team: holion
  escalation: kelmir-drudor
  nonce: d13cd7

**Ticket QP-4412: Query planner regression after Marlowe 3.2 upgrade**

Heads up for the security review folks: since the Marlowe 3.2 bump, the planner in Quillbase sometimes picks a full-table scan on the audit_events table instead of the index path. Not just a perf problem — it bypasses the row-filter rewrite that enforces tenant isolation, so a crafted query could leak cross-tenant rows. Repro is deterministic on staging with the Fenwick dataset. Rollback candidate is tagged below. The offending build is:

session token of tajef-bageg = htk21_5d90d574934f3ccae6437

Ticket: Unlock migration vault for Ironvine ORM refactor

New team members: the legacy Ironvine ORM layer is being replaced module by module, and the schema snapshots needed for safe refactoring sit in a locked vault nobody has opened since the last owner left. We recovered the credentials from escrow this week. The passphrase follows below.

unlock words, kajog-yawip: istwyn-casath-aldok

**Q: How are duplicate customer records handled before a release?**

The Merrowfield dedup job runs nightly, matching on normalized name, region, and account fingerprint. Candidate merges above the confidence threshold are applied automatically; borderline cases queue for manual review and must be cleared before you cut a release. Merge decisions are fully reversible for 30 days. The review queue and threshold settings are documented here:

operations page: https://jenkins.zemvarcloud.local/job/merge_requests/repo/build/73930b4b30f0a8ed